[Detailed description of the invention] This invention relates to a protective net that is vertically installed at a predetermined interval from the surrounding wall of a building to prevent falling objects from scattering.The protective net is particularly required to be opened by the wind pressure during strong winds. This invention relates to a protective net that can prevent damage caused by wind pressure by providing cracks at certain locations and allowing wind to flow out through the cracks.

In general, protective nets used to cover the walls of buildings to prevent falling objects from scattering during repairs etc. are made of multiple joists that protrude from each upper edge. By fixing each to the horizontal shaft installed between the tips, and connecting the side edges of the protective net adjacent to the cables hanging from the tips of each joist with binding wires, the net is made into a single piece. It is constructed to cover the building wall with a protective net.

However, when the net is made into one thick protective net like this, the entire surface receives wind during strong winds.
In addition, there is almost no escape for wind that enters between the wall surface and the protective net, and as a result, there is a risk that the entire protective net will be greatly agitated, creating a very dangerous situation. In this method, the binding wires connecting the protective nets are cut to improve the outflow of wind, but this method has the disadvantage that cutting the binding wires and restoring them requires extremely troublesome work.

This invention improves the above-mentioned drawbacks, and will be explained below based on the embodiment shown in the drawings. The projecting beams 2 are attached to the roof parapet 7 of the building at required intervals,
A roller 8 is provided at the upper end of this projecting beam 2.

The curing gondola 5, which can be raised and lowered by itself, has a receiving member 9 on the inner side of its lower part, the end of which contacts the peripheral wall surface 4 of the building to catch falling objects, and the winding drum 10 equipped therewith is fed out. After the cables 11 are supported by the rollers 8, they are tied to desired positions on the roof, and the plurality of curing gondolas 5 suspended by the cables 11 are arranged in a line along the peripheral wall 4 of the building. Arranged horizontally.

The upper end edge of each protective net 1 is attached to a horizontal shaft 13 installed between support rods 12 protruding from both sides of the tip of each of the projecting beams 2 with a hanging tool 14. Both side edges 1a are connected to the cables 11 at predetermined intervals by binding lines 3, etc., and the wall surfaces are covered with a plurality of protective nets 1 integrated in this way.

The present invention provides cracks 16, for example, in an inverted U-shape, which can be opened at a plurality of locations in the protective net 1, and Velcro fasteners 15 for closing the openings at the positions of the cracks 16.
It is made by pasting it on.

Each protective net l-1 suspended from each horizontal shaft 13
The opening created by the crack 16 is always closed by the Velcro fastener 15, and in strong winds, the entire protective net swells greatly due to wind that enters between the wall surface 4 and the protective net 1, or wind that is applied from the outside direction. Velcro fastener 15 due to the wind pressure
The adhesive peels off and the crack 16 opens wide, making it easy for the wind that has flowed in between the protective net 1 and the wall surface 4 to flow out, so that the integrated protective net 1 is exposed to wind pressure over the entire surface and becomes large. It is possible to prevent the fear of being agitated.

また強風がやんだ際には剥離したベルクロファスナを貼
着するだけで一体化した防護用ネットを再現して使用で
きるものである。
Furthermore, when the strong winds subside, the integrated protective net can be recreated and used simply by attaching the peeled Velcro fasteners.

By having the above-mentioned structure, this device dynamically opens cracks in the protective net due to wind pressure during strong winds, facilitates the outflow of wind, and prevents the protective net from being greatly agitated. In addition, when the wind subsides, the integrated protective net can be recreated and used by simply attaching the Velcro fasteners, making it extremely convenient to use as there is no need to remove the protective net during strong winds. It has the advantage of being
